Summer is finally here, and if you’re like most people, your schedule probably looks a little different than it did a few months ago.
Between vacations, cookouts, weekend trips, kids being out of school, and longer evenings spent with friends and family, it’s easy for fitness routines to take a back seat. We see it every year at FitClub Wellesley. Members get busy, miss a few workouts, and suddenly feel like they’ve fallen completely off track.
The truth is, summer doesn’t have to derail your progress.
In fact, one of the biggest mistakes people make is believing they need to be “all in” or they might as well not try at all. Fitness doesn’t work that way. Long-term success comes from staying consistent, even when life gets hectic.
Maybe you can’t make it to the gym five days a week right now. That’s okay. Two or three quality workouts each week can go a long way toward maintaining your strength, energy, and momentum.
One thing we often tell our members is to focus on the habits that matter most. If your schedule is packed, don’t worry about being perfect. Instead, ask yourself:
- Am I staying active?
- Am I getting my workouts in most weeks?
- Am I drinking enough water?
- Am I making decent food choices most of the time?
If the answer is yes, you’re doing better than you think.
Summer is also a great time to find ways to move outside of the gym. Take a walk after dinner, spend time at the beach, go for a bike ride, play with your kids or grandkids, or simply spend more time on your feet. It all counts.
Of course, summer also brings plenty of opportunities to enjoy food and celebrate with family and friends. The goal isn’t to avoid every barbecue or turn down every dessert. The goal is balance. Enjoy the special moments, then get back to your normal routine at the next meal or the next day.
One vacation, one weekend, or one missed workout won’t undo your progress. Giving up because of it might.
As we move through the summer months, challenge yourself to focus less on perfection and more on consistency. Keep showing up. Keep moving. Keep making choices that support your goals.
When September arrives, you’ll be glad you stayed connected to your routine instead of waiting for the “perfect time” to start again.
